Description: SPEECH ENHANCEMENT BASED ON WAVELET DENOISING
Abstract: - Noise is an unwanted and inevitable interference in any form of communication. It is
non-informative and plays the role of sucking the intelligence of the original signal. Any kind of
processing of the signal contributes to the noise addition. A signal traveling through the channel
also gathers lots of noise. It degrades the quality of the information signal. The effect of noise
could be reduced only at the cost of the bandwidth of the channel which is again undesired as
bandwidth is a precious resource. Hence to regenerate original signal, it is tried to reduce the
power of the noise signal or in the other way, raise the power level of the informative signal, at
the receiver end this leads to improvement in the signal to noise ratio (SNR). There are several
ways in doing it and here the focus is on adaptive Signal processing new technique (Grazing
Estimation method) to improving the signal to noise ratio.-SPEECH ENHANCEMENT BASED ON WAVELET DENOISING
